97 Explorer Headlights

I cannot see at night with my current headlights. I can drive with my highbeams on and no notices. I had them adjusted already and still ot difference.(they even set them higher than normal for me) I have also tried different bulbs and had noluck. Any suggestions?

Are the lenses on the pods discoloured or sandblasted? Any kind of hazing can block a great deal of light. If the lenses are indeed nice and clear, you might try measuring the voltage drop across the headlight bulb with the headlights turned on and hooked up...... should be within one volt of source voltage.

I hesitate to voice this last idea but I once had a customer that thought their daytime running lights were actually "automatic" lights and accused me of not being able to fix their tailights properly..... Ford DRLs run the high beam filament at half power....
